Despite their unhealthy image, frozen foods are becoming more popular in the warm, humid summer weather.
According to the retail industry, sales of dairy products -- including Korea Yakult's frozen yogurt -- have soared. Sales of frozen dairy products totaled 5 billion won in the first five months last year, and the same amount was achieved this year 10 days earlier, Korea Yakult said.
"Frozen yogurt is popular for its nutritional benefits, and we are expecting to reach 25 billion won by the end of this year," a company spokesperson said.
And sales of frozen alcohol have also climbed.
Sales of Lotte Liquor's Chum Churum (meaning "soft, like first" in Korean) Cool have climbed 70.5 percent since its launch last June
